在Linux系统中,你可以使用多种命令来查找文件夹的名字。常用的命令是 `find` 和 `locate`(需提前通过 `updatedb` 更新数据库)。下面是这些命令的基本使用方法:
1. 使用`find`命令:
假设你想在一个特定目录下查找叫做 "target_folder" 的文件夹:
sh
find /path/to/search/in type d name 'target_folder'
在上面的命令里,
`/path/to/search/in` 需要被实际需要搜索的文件夹路径所替换,
`type d` 表明你仅寻找目录(也就是文件夹)。
`name 'target_folder'` 是你正在寻找的文件夹名字。
2. 使用`locate`命令:
你可以通过 `updatedb` 命令来确保你的搜索数据库是最新的,不过这通常是一个后台运行的服务在定期做这个更新。
然后直接使用 `locate` 来寻找:
sh
locate target_folder | grep "/$"
上述 `grep "/$"` 用于仅显示那些匹配项作为目录的结果。如果你知道确切的位置可以在 `locate` 之前限制搜索范围,比如:
sh
locate b '\target_folder$' /home
请注意,对于大范围或者深度层次搜索,使用 `find` 通常是更可靠和直观的方法。请依据实际环境和安全策略选择适合的操作系统级别的权限操作这些功能。
希望这些指导能够帮助到你!如果有更多的问题或需要更具体的命令示例,请告诉我。
发表评论